My suggestions are:
1. Spring chicken register (5,2) CHECK IN. Anagram of chicken (spring is indicator)
2. Cut down and captured, grabbing criminal closer (5-7)CLOSE CROPPED. Cut down is def. Anagram of closer (indicator is criminal) inside copped (caught)
3. Going from coin-teller to successful speculator (5-7) MONEY SPINNER. Coin=money and teller as in story teller=Spinner
4. Bishop abandons a workhorse to grass (3,2) DOB IN. Dobbin (workhorse) missing B for bishop. Grass as in inform on.
5. Old British man with socialist wit is attached to pioneering transport (7,5)COVERED WAGON. Cove (old British man) Red (Socialist) Wag (wit) On (attached to).
